Glazers and Commercial Challenges
- 💰 The Glazers are reportedly unhappy with the club's financial situation and are unwilling to fund operations from their own pockets.
- 📊 Manchester United faces commercial failings, including a lack of shirt sleeve and training kit sponsors, contributing to growing club debt.
- 📉 The club has dropped significantly on the rich list, losing substantial money and facing a further £130 million deficit this season.
Michael Carrick's Managerial Prospects
- 👏 Michael Carrick has achieved Manager of the Month, a positive development for the team.
- ⚽ There are rumors of interest from Spurs in Carrick, raising questions about his future at United.
- ⏱️ The speaker argues against giving Carrick the permanent job immediately, citing the limited sample size of five games and the need to assess his long-term tactical capabilities.
Future Managerial Strategy
- 🎯 The choice of future manager hinges on the club's ambition and financial capacity.
- 🚀 An ambitious club with a large budget would pursue a world-class, experienced coach accustomed to big egos and major competitions.
- 🌱 An unambitious club, constrained by finances and existing players, might find Carrick the most suitable option due to his club knowledge and ability to work with the current squad.
